不同绿肥作物覆盖对橡胶园土壤理化性质的影响

【摘要】 为筛选能有效改良云南开割橡胶园土壤肥力的覆盖绿肥,研究了10种豆科绿肥的养分特性与积累量,探讨了不同豆科绿肥覆盖对橡胶园土壤理化性质的影响作用。结果表明,10种供试豆科绿肥均为富含N、K的有机绿肥。灌木、亚灌木绿肥的干物质积累量高于草本和藤本绿肥,草本和藤本绿肥的氮、磷、钾含量则高于灌木、亚灌木绿肥。为取得最佳的覆盖效果,筛选绿肥时应考虑灌木、亚灌木与草本、藤本相结合。绿肥覆盖后胶园土壤有机质、速效磷、速效钾较对照均有不同程度的提高,但差异不显著;土壤全氮、碱解氮含量和pH值变化不明显。综合比较10种绿肥的养分特性、对土壤理化性状的影响,结合田间观测结果,初步筛选出距瓣豆、卵叶山蚂蝗、白花灰叶豆3种绿肥对云南山地胶园土壤肥力有一定的提升和维持作用,为云南开割胶园覆盖绿肥的筛选奠定了基础。
【Abstract】 A field experiment was conducted to screen mulch green manure that can effectively improve soil fertility in Yunnan tapped rubber plantation.These were discussed that nutrients property and accumulation of 10 kinds of leguminous green manure content and its influences on soil physical and chemical property in Yunnan rubber plantation.The results show that the 10 kinds of green manure are rich in N,K.Dry matter accumulation quantity of bush is higher than herbage and vine.Nitrogen,phosphorus,and potassium content of herbage and vine are higher than the shrubs and bushes.To achieve the best mulching effect,bush,vine and herbs should be combined when screening mulch green manure.Soil organic matter,available P,available potassium contents are improved to varying degrees after green manure mulched,but no significant difference.But Soil total nitrogen,available nitrogen content and pH value does not change significantly.Comprehensive comparing nutrient characteristics and its influence on soil physical and chemical property of these green manures,combined with the field observation results,Centrosema pubescens Benth,Desmodium ovalifolium,Tephrosia candida DC have certain ascension and maintain function to soil fertility.Results are help to screen mulch greenmanure suitable for Yunnan tapped rubber plantation.
